Job Description

As a Project Manager III, you will manage and oversee all aspects of large, complex projects to ensure they are completed on time, within scope, and within budget. You are responsible for managing project scope, cost, schedule, internal staffing, and external vendors, while serving as a key liaison between internal teams, leadership, customers, and suppliers. This role operates with a high degree of independence and collaboration and contributes to moderately to highly complex project initiatives.

Responsibilities:

  • Direct and manage large, complex project development from initiation through completion.
  • Define project scope, goals, deliverables, and success criteria in collaboration with senior management and key stakeholders.
  • Develop and maintain full‑scale project plans, execution strategies, timelines, budgets, and communications documents.
  • Identify, manage, and track project dependencies, risks, critical path, and milestones using appropriate project management tools.
  • Monitor and control project performance, tracking milestones and deliverables to ensure consistent execution.
  • Manage changes in project scope, assess potential impacts, identify concerns, and develop contingency and mitigation plans.
  • Develop and deliver progress reports, proposals, requirements documentation, and presentations for internal leadership and customers.
  • Communicate project expectations, priorities, and progress to team members, leadership, and stakeholders.
  • Serve as the primary liaison with internal and external project stakeholders on an ongoing basis.
  • Set and manage expectations with customers, ensuring alignment with contractual and PO requirements.
  • Understand and communicate all customer, contract, and PO requirements to internal workstreams to ensure successful execution.
  • Proactively communicate project status, risks, and needs to customers.
  • Identify and manage customer‑critical milestones, deliverables, and success factors.
  • Delegate tasks and responsibilities effectively and build accountability across cross‑functional teams.
  • Identify and resolve issues and conflicts within the project team.

Qualifications:

  • Associate’s degree required; Bachelor’s degree preferred
  • 5 years required, 7 years experience preferred of directing work in a large-scale project management capacity, including all aspects of process development and execution
  • Business and management principles, including strategic planning, resource allocation, and production methods
  • Prior experience with managing people and processes to achieve objectives
  • Ability to build effective business relationships with other functional areas to best support mutual objectives
  • Excellent problem-solving skills and ability to analyze workflow and processes to provide productive service to internal and external customers
  • Interpersonal, conflict management, and negotiation skills required, including strong human relations skills to supervise and develop assigned employees effectively
  • Adept at conducting research into project-related issues and products
  • Ability to learn, understand, and apply new technologies
  • Ability to effectively prioritize and execute tasks
  • Effective written and verbal communication skills
  • Excellent computer skills

About Wesco

At Wesco, we believe life should run smoothly. As a leading provider of business-to-business distribution, logistics services and supply chain solutions, we create a world that you can depend on. Harnessing 100 years of ingenuity and expertise, we increase profitability, improve productivity and mitigate risk for approximately 150,000 customers worldwide. With millions of products and locations in more than 50 countries, Wesco is your partner in progress.

Our company’s greatest asset is our people. From our corporate and field offices to our distribution sites, Wesco employs over 20,000 professionals around the globe. We’re committed to fostering diversity and inclusion across our workforce by embracing the unique perspectives, authenticity, and individuality our team members contribute to the company.

Headquartered in Pittsburgh, Wesco is a publicly traded (NYSE: WCC) FORTUNE 500® company with 2023 net sales of $22.4 billion.
